                      7: When the  kernel starts  up, it reserves  a block of  physically contiguous
                      8: memory  (of size  PPHHYYSS_MMEEMM) for  one or  more device  drivers to  use.  Any
                      9: device  driver  can  request some  of  this  memory;  to  do so,  it  calls
                     10: ggeettPPhhyyssMMeemm()  from within  its  load routine.   _n_u_m_B_y_t_e_s  gives the  number
                     11: number of bytes it needs.
                     12: 
                     13: If it can meet the request, ggeettPPhhyyssMMeemm() returns the virtual address of the
                     14: start  of  the  region  allocated.   This  region  has  contiguous  virtual
                     15: addresses  within  kernel  data  space,  as  well  as  contiguous  physical
                     16: addresses.  If  it cannot grant  the request, ggeettPPhhyyssMMeemm()  returns 0.  Use
                     17: routine vvttoopp() to determine the physical address of the region.
